Biathlon: Sweden names team for Östersund World Cup opener
Originally published in SVT Sport on November 24, 2025
The biathlon season begins this weekend at the Östersund ski stadium, and Sweden has confirmed its squad for the World Cup opener.
Linn Gestblom returns to top-level competition after roughly 650 days away; her last World Cup start was in Antholz in January 2024. “It feels incredibly fun to be back racing,” she said. She explained that ahead of this season she removed the brace she used before surgery, and despite ups and downs over the past year, her goal all along was to be on the start line in Östersund.
Head coach Johannes Lukas has selected five women for now and is keeping the final women’s place open. Anna-Karin Heijdenberg, Johanna Skottheim and Sara Andersson are competing for that last spot. “We’re in a slightly special situation on the women’s side. We’ll see how training develops before deciding the entries for each race. The whole team is training together in Östersund, and from that we can make as fair and comprehensive a selection as possible,” said Lukas.
On the men’s side, debutant Melker Nordgren has been given an opportunity and will make his World Cup debut on home snow. “It’ll be really fun to race the World Cup, and doing it at home makes it even more special,” Nordgren said.
SVT will broadcast the biathlon as usual; the season starts on Saturday at 13:15.
Sweden’s squad for Östersund
Women: - Anna Magnusson (Piteå Skidskytteklubb) - Ella Halvarsson (Biathlon Östersund) - Elvira Öberg (Piteå Skidskytteklubb) - Hanna Öberg (Piteå Skidskytteklubb) - Linn Gestblom (SK Bore)
Women – final spot contenders: - Anna-Karin Heijdenberg - Johanna Skottheim - Sara Andersson
Men: - Jesper Nelin (Biathlon Östersund) - Malte Stefansson (Oxbergs IF) - Martin Ponsiluoma (Tullus SG) - Melker Nordgren (Ornäs IK Skidskytte) - Sebastian Samuelsson (I 21 IF) - Viktor Brandt (I 2 IF)
